SOME of the top rodeo competitors from Queensland, New South Wales and Victoria will head to Narrandera and Whittlesea for rodeos in the Australian Professional Rodeo Association this Saturday.
The rodeos will be the perfect preparation for competitors aiming to compete in the three rodeos on the Victorian long weekend in March and the 10 rodeos in Queensland, New South Wales and Victoria on the Easter long weekend.
The Narrandera Rodeo in New South Wales is on Saturday at the grounds in Racecourse Rd, Narrandera, and action will be in all eight APRA championship events, starting at 6:30pm.
Lurg, Victoria, contractor Garry McPhee will travel to Narrandera with the bucking stock for the saddle bronc, bareback bronc and bull ride.
At the beginning of February, Queensland rider Cameron Webster was at the top of the standings in saddle bronc.
New South Wales rider Josh Birks was a clear leader in bull ride standings and Ben Hall from New South Wales had won twice as much money than any other rider in bareback.
Upper Horton (NSW) contractors Malcolm and Eddie Gill are making the long trip to Victoria with their bucking stock for the Saturday rodeo at Whittlesea.
Action in all eight championship events will be at the Whittlesea Showgrounds starting at 6pm.
Three of the cowboys to watch in saddle bronc will be Greg Hamilton (Qld) and Brad Pierce (NSW) at Narrandera and Luke Chaplain (VIC) at Whittlesea.
